Hello community, here is the log from the commit of package plasma-addons for openSUSE:12.1 checked in at 2011-10-27 19:59:57 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Comparing /work/SRC/openSUSE:12.1/plasma-addons (Old) and /work/SRC/openSUSE:12.1/.plasma-addons.new (New) 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Package is "plasma-addons", Maintainer is "kde-maintain...@suse.de" Changes: -------- --- /work/SRC/openSUSE:12.1/plasma-addons/plasma-addons.changes 2011-10-24 13:19:44.000000000 +0200 +++ /work/SRC/openSUSE:12.1/.plasma-addons.new/plasma-addons.changes 2011-10-28 17:13:30.000000000 +0200 @@ -1,0 +2,14 @@ +Thu Oct 27 12:30:56 UTC 2011 - idon...@suse.com + +- Remove redundant COPTING file bnc#726121 + +------------------------------------------------------------------- +Mon Oct 24 11:44:47 UTC 2011 - sasc...@gmx.de + +- Moved contacts, events and lancelot plasmoids into new 'akonadi' and + 'lancelot' subpackages. Removes dependency on kdepim4 / akonadi from + the base package +- Set license to SPDX style (GPL-2.0+) +- Removed outdated %clean section + +------------------------------------------------------------------- 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Other differences: ------------------ ++++++ plasma-addons.spec ++++++ --- /var/tmp/diff_new_pack.xCypUI/_old 2011-10-28 17:13:31.000000000 +0200 +++ /var/tmp/diff_new_pack.xCypUI/_new 2011-10-28 17:13:31.000000000 +0200 @@ -19,8 +19,8 @@ Name: plasma-addons Version: 4.7.2 -Release: 1 -License: GPLv2+ +Release: 0 +License: GPL-2.0+ Summary: Additional Plasma Widgets Url: http://www.kde.org/ Group: System/GUI/KDE @@ -38,7 +38,8 @@ BuildRequires: libqimageblitz-devel BuildRequires: marble-devel BuildRequires: python-qt4-devel -Requires: kdepim4-runtime +Recommends: plasma-addons-akonadi +Recommends: plasma-addons-lancelot Recommends: plasma-addons-marble Provides: extragear-plasma = 4.0.80 Obsoletes: extragear-plasma < 4.0.80 @@ -54,17 +55,16 @@ Requires(post): shared-mime-info Requires(postun): shared-mime-info %kde4_runtime_requires -%kde4_pimlibs_requires -%kde4_akonadi_requires %description Additional plasmoids from upstream for use on the KDE workspace %package devel -License: GPLv2+ Summary: Development files for %{name} Group: Development/Libraries/KDE Requires: plasma-addons = %{version} +Requires: plasma-addons-akonadi = %{version} +Requires: plasma-addons-lancelot = %{version} Provides: kde4-plasma-addons-devel = 4.2.96 Obsoletes: kde4-plasma-addons-devel < 4.2.96 @@ -72,8 +72,29 @@ Development files and headers needed to build software using %{name} +%package akonadi +Summary: Additional Plasmoids Depending on Akonadi +Group: System/GUI/KDE +Requires: kdepim4-runtime +%kde4_pimlibs_requires +%kde4_akonadi_requires +%kde4_runtime_requires + +%description akonadi +Additional plasmoids from upstream that require Akonadi + +%package lancelot +Summary: Additional Lancelot Launcher Plasmoid +Group: System/GUI/KDE +Requires: kdepim4-runtime +%kde4_pimlibs_requires +%kde4_akonadi_requires +%kde4_runtime_requires + +%description lancelot +Additional launcher plasmoid from upstream that requires Akonadi + %package marble -License: GPLv2+ Summary: Additional Plasmoids Depending on Marble Group: System/GUI/KDE Requires: marble = %{version} @@ -90,6 +111,10 @@ %patch1 %patch2 +# Remove reduntant COPYING file bnc#726121 +# Christian Weilbach <duns...@web.de> agreed to license this under GPLv2+ +rm applets/incomingmsg/COPYING + %build %cmake_kde4 -d build %make_jobs @@ -109,13 +134,18 @@ /sbin/ldconfig %{_kde4_bindir}/update-mime-database %{_datadir}/mime &> /dev/null || : +%post akonadi -p /sbin/ldconfig + +%postun akonadi -p /sbin/ldconfig + +%post lancelot -p /sbin/ldconfig + +%postun lancelot -p /sbin/ldconfig + %post marble -p /sbin/ldconfig %postun marble -p /sbin/ldconfig -%clean -rm -rf %{buildroot} - %files devel %defattr(-,root,root) %dir %{_includedir}/lancelot-datamodels @@ -128,6 +158,29 @@ %{_kde4_libdir}/librtm.so %{_kde4_appsdir}/cmake/modules/FindLancelot* +%files akonadi +%defattr(-,root,root) +%doc COPYING +%{_kde4_modulesdir}/kcm_plasma_runner_events.so +%{_kde4_modulesdir}/krunner_contacts.so +%{_kde4_modulesdir}/plasma_runner_events.so +%{_kde4_servicesdir}/plasma-runner-contacts.desktop +%{_kde4_servicesdir}/plasma-runner-events*.desktop + +%files lancelot +%defattr(-,root,root) +%doc COPYING +%{_kde4_appsdir}/lancelot +%{_kde4_bindir}/lancelot +%{_kde4_modulesdir}/plasma_applet_lancelot*.so +%{_kde4_libdir}/liblancelot.so.* +%{_kde4_libdir}/liblancelot-datamodels.so.* +%{_kde4_iconsdir}/*/*/apps/lancelot*.png +%{_kde4_appsdir}/desktoptheme/*/lancelot +%{_kde4_servicesdir}/lancelot.desktop +%{_kde4_servicesdir}/plasma-applet-lancelot*.desktop +%{_datadir}/mime/packages/lancelotpart-mime.xml + %files marble %defattr(-,root,root) %doc COPYING @@ -137,31 +190,36 @@ %files %defattr(-,root,root) %doc COPYING -%{_datadir}/mime/packages/lancelotpart-mime.xml %dir %{_kde4_appsdir}/plasma-applet-opendesktop-activities %{_kde4_appsdir}/bball %{_kde4_appsdir}/desktoptheme/ -%{_kde4_appsdir}/lancelot +%exclude %{_kde4_appsdir}/desktoptheme/*/lancelot %{_kde4_appsdir}/plasma/services/ %{_kde4_appsdir}/plasma-applet-* %{_kde4_appsdir}/plasmaboard/ %{_kde4_appsdir}/plasma_pastebin %{_kde4_appsdir}/plasma_wallpaper_pattern %{_kde4_appsdir}/rssnow -%{_kde4_bindir}/lancelot %config %{_kde_config_dir}/*.knsrc %{_kde4_iconsdir}/*/*/apps/* -%{_kde4_libdir}/liblancelot.so.* -%{_kde4_libdir}/liblancelot-datamodels.so.* +%exclude %{_kde4_iconsdir}/*/*/apps/lancelot*.png %{_kde4_libdir}/libplasma*.so.* %{_kde4_libdir}/librtm.so.* %{_kde4_modulesdir}/kcm_*.so +%exclude %{_kde4_modulesdir}/kcm_plasma_runner_events.so %{_kde4_modulesdir}/krunner_*.so +%exclude %{_kde4_modulesdir}/krunner_contacts.so %{_kde4_modulesdir}/plasma_* +%exclude %{_kde4_modulesdir}/plasma_applet_lancelot*.so +%exclude %{_kde4_modulesdir}/plasma_runner_events.so %{_kde4_modulesdir}/plasma-applet_systemloadviewer.so %exclude %{_kde4_modulesdir}/plasma_wallpaper_marble.so %{_kde4_servicesdir}/* %{_kde4_servicetypes}/plasma_*.desktop +%exclude %{_kde4_servicesdir}/lancelot.desktop +%exclude %{_kde4_servicesdir}/plasma-runner-contacts.desktop +%exclude %{_kde4_servicesdir}/plasma-runner-events*.desktop +%exclude %{_kde4_servicesdir}/plasma-applet-lancelot*.desktop %exclude %{_kde4_servicesdir}/plasma-wallpaper-marble.desktop %changelog -- To unsubscribe, e-mail: opensuse-commit+unsubscr...@opensuse.org For additional commands, e-mail: opensuse-commit+h...@opensuse.org